Hello!
I have been using the HP envy x360 laptop for many years, and all of a sudden a bolt appears in the bottom right corner of the hinge. I have seen that others have had this problem.
I have read the maintenance and service document as well as watched the part removal video on the HP Support YouTube channel and believe that I can take apart the laptop to at least view the problem. I was wondering whether it would be possible to replace the pin. Thanks!
Kind regards, Daniel
PS: Below is a picture from the part removal video on the HP Support video which I believe is the failing part.
10-17-2021 10:39 AM
So the video is not your laptop? If that screw is broken on your laptop or has pulled out you may need to replace the whole base assembly. It has the mount for the screw. If the mount is stripped it cannot be repaired
